The Steering wheel angle sensor uses two sensors ( A-sensor and B-sensor ) to determine the direction of the rotation. The main components of each sensor are LED, photo transistor and slit plate. The slit plate, which has 45 holes, is installed between LED and photo transistor, and generates signals if slit plate rotates according to the steering wheel rotation. The sensor signals are generated by photo transistor which is driven whenever the light passes through the holes. The HECU detects operating speed and direction of the steering wheel by this input signal, and the signal is used to input signal for anti-roll control.
The HECU checks the CAN communcation lines for normal control and if a steering anlge sensor's message is not received for a certain period, this DTC is set.
